What are the products of electrolysis of copper sulphate?

The products of electrolysing copper sulfate solution with inert electrodes (carbon/graphite or platinum) are copper metal and oxygen gas.

How does electrolysis make pure copper from a lump of impure copper?

The anode (positive electrode ) is made from impure copper and the cathode (negative electrode) is made from pure copper. During electrolysis, the anode loses mass as copper dissolves, and the cathode gains mass as copper is deposited.

How does temperature affect electrolysis of copper sulphate?

Temperature is an important parameter for copper electrowinning process. The resistance of electrolyte solution and cell is reduced with the rise in temperature leading to an increased rate of electrodeposition of copper. In addition, the temperature of the electrolyte positively affects the quality of cathode copper.

Why do we use electrolysis to purify copper?

Electrolysis of copper transfers copper atoms from an impure copper anode to a pure copper cathode, leaving the impurities behind. The Fe and Zn impurities are more easily oxidized than Cu. When current passes through the cell, these impurities go into solution from the anode, along with Cu.
